Bjorn 69 Convertible/HALF member/Houston,Tx ---------------------------------------------------------------------- Subject: Re: [FGF] Hi and question From: "Douglas Cole" <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> Date: Tue, 18 Dec 2007 09:57:49 -0800 IMHO, what is wrong with the way it was designed... it was CHEAP. Mono rear leaf springs where one year only on one model (as I have read on the internet, so it must be right!). We also want to lower it just a bit for a better stance as we are replacing the rims/tries with 16 or 17s. The front sway bar is smaller then the rear sway bar on my V-6 Thirdgen and it doesn't even have a rear sway bar. If the handling on that car is considered "adequate" then even the lowest suspension level on the Thirdgen is phenomenal. Overall the car is boring. It doesn't go (230 w/ Powerglide and 2.5x rear end ratio), it doesn't stop (4 wheel drum brakes) and it doesn't corner (for all the reasons I listed above). I am not looking to replace the upper and lower control arms with tubular ones or anything like that but for $1,600 bucks it seems I can get: Multi-leaf rear spring, coil springs, shocks, full polyurethane bushings, and a sway bar kit.
